“Claws” star Niecy Nash covers the September issue of Essence Magazine photographed by Sophy Holland.
On filming sex scenes in her 40s: “I’ve been in this business for more than 20 years. How did you all wait until I was on the south side of 40 to be like, ‘Can you get on camera and roll around in the bed with these men?”
On balancing motherhood with auditions: “I was the only one dragging kids in there, but three words that I started to live by in that time was ‘no matter what.’”
On persevering through personal tragedies: “If you look at my track record: She saw her mother get shot. She buried her only brother. She went through a horrible divorce. She lost her church. Then to look at [my life now], in many ways that does feel like a Cinderella story”
On finding her footing in the entertainment industry: “For a long time the industry was polite, but they were like, ‘Dear, you have a lane. You do broad comedy. Stay over there.’ I had to be a lady-in-waiting and bide my time until they started to recognize. My first time doing dramatic work garnered me back-to-back Emmy nominations.”
